in·fant
I i
  • noun infant A very young child or baby. 1
  • noun infant a child during the earliest period of its life, especially before he or she can walk; baby. 1
  • noun infant Law. a person who is not of full age, especially one who has not reached the age of 18 years; a minor. 1
  • noun infant a beginner, as in experience or learning; novice: The new candidate is a political infant. 1
  • noun infant anything in the first stage of existence or progress. 1
  • adjective infant of or relating to infants or infancy: infant years. 1
  • adjective infant being in infancy: an infant king. 1
  • adjective infant being in the earliest stage: an infant industry. 1
  • adjective infant of or relating to the legal state of infancy; minor. 1
